Kenneth G. Franqueiro a157f716a5 Implement multi-target options and refactor code
This adds support for --all, --platform=all, and --arch=all.

In order to accommodate outputting multiple directories for multiple
platforms and architectures, this also implements a new directory
structure under the output folder (distinguished by both platform and
arch).  This structure is applied even to OS X distributions, which
formerly were output directly to an .app folder.  This could be considered
a backwards-incompatible change.

One other backwards-incompatible change is the value that the packager
function passes to the callback, which is now always an array of paths,
rather than just a single path.

The behavior of the icon option has also been modified to use its
basename and apply .ico or .icns depending on platform, to make it
usable with --all and --platform=all.  This attempts to maximize
backwards compatibility, by allowing a full filename to be specified,
but replacing the filename's extension with what is appropriate for
each target platform.  Alternatively, the extension can now be omitted.

In the process of implementing this, it became evident that some things
were being done in 3 different places, and weren't always being done
consistently, so I've deduplicated everything I could.

This also includes a few other changes to improve stability for
multi-target runs, and other fixes:

* Avoid targeting darwin if the environment doesn't support symlinks,
  to avoid the process bailing out on Windows
* Implement --overwrite centrally in index.js such that it explicitly
  skips if an output directory already exists, for consistency with
  all target platforms and to avoid any possible errors that would halt
  operation during one target of a multi-target run
* Use ncp instead of mv to move to finalPath, which avoids flakiness
  I noticed when testing on Windows 8 especially with multi-target runs
* Simplify temp directory logic by using a nested structure, so there
  is only one top-level directory to clean up
* Reinstate fix from #55 which seems to have been clobbered by a later
  merge
* linux.createApp now resolves to the final output directory;
  it was formerly resolving to the executable path
* mac.createApp now replaces space with underscore in bundle IDs
* Only the platform modules that are needed are loaded
* The win32 module only loads rcedit if needed

This also fixes a couple of missing updates to docs (readme/usage).

Usage: electron-packager <sourcedir> <appname> --platform=<platform> --arch=<arch> --version=<version>
Required options
platform all, or one or more of: linux, win32, darwin (comma-delimited if multiple)
arch all, ia32, x64
version see https://github.com/atom/electron/releases
Example electron-packager ./ FooBar --platform=darwin --arch=x64 --version=0.28.2
Optional options
all equivalent to --platform=all --arch=all
out the dir to put the app into at the end. defaults to current working dir
icon the icon file to use as the icon for the app
app-bundle-id bundle identifier to use in the app plist
app-version version to set for the app
helper-bundle-id bundle identifier to use in the app helper plist
ignore do not copy files into App whose filenames regex .match this string
prune runs `npm prune --production` on the app
overwrite if output directory for a platform already exists, replaces it rather than skipping it
asar packages the source code within your app into an archive
sign should contain the identity to be used when running `codesign` (OS X only)
